This film features a cross-disciplinary project which resulted from a collaboration between …
This film features a cross-disciplinary project which resulted from a collaboration between a mathematics teacher and an art teacher, celebrating the beauty of both fields. Although its sub-title is Making Calculus Delicious, the math featured in the book is primarily geometry and algebra, with students creating artistic interpretations of mathematical concepts and formulas. The translation of mathematics to art promoted fresh conceptual discussion and creative thinking, and inspires consideration of the elegance in mathematics.

The goal of this task is to use ideas about linear functions …
The goal of this task is to use ideas about linear functions in order to determine when certain angles are right angles. The key piece of knowledge implemented is that two lines (which are not vertical or horizontal) are perpendicular when their slopes are inverse reciprocals of one another.
